Toyota is one of the most iconic and influential automobile manufacturers in the world, known for its dedication to quality, reliability, and innovation. Founded in 1937 by Kiichiro Toyoda, the company has grown to become a global powerhouse in the automotive industry, with a presence in virtually every corner of the world. Toyota has earned a reputation for producing vehicles that combine cutting-edge technology with outstanding durability, making them a top choice for drivers seeking practicality, longevity, and value.

One of the key elements that sets Toyota apart is its focus on innovation. The company was one of the pioneers of hybrid technology with the launch of the Prius in 1997, which quickly became the world’s best-selling hybrid vehicle. Toyota’s ongoing commitment to sustainability is evident in its development of hybrid and electric vehicles, such as the Prius, Corolla Hybrid, and the upcoming Toyota bZ series of fully electric vehicles. This forward-thinking approach to eco-friendly mobility is part of Toyota’s broader vision to contribute to a cleaner, more sustainable future.

Another significant factor behind Toyota’s global success is its focus on manufacturing efficiency. 

 

The company’s Toyota Production System (TPS) revolutionized the automotive industry by emphasizing lean manufacturing techniques and continuous improvement. This system has allowed Toyota to maintain high-quality standards while keeping costs manageable, resulting in reliable vehicles that are affordable for a wide range of consumers.
